Python是一門非常流行的編程語言,可以用來進行數學計算和數據分析。在Python中,計算算術平均值是非常簡單的。
# 計算算術平均值的函數 def average(numbers): total = 0 count = 0 for num in numbers: total += num count += 1 return total / count
上面的代碼定義了一個函數average,該函數將列表中的所有數字相加,并除以列表中數字的個數來計算算術平均值。
使用該函數計算列表[1, 2, 3, 4, 5]的算術平均值:
numbers = [1, 2, 3, 4, 5] avg = average(numbers) print('算術平均值為:', avg)
程序輸出:
算術平均值為: 3.0
通過運行該程序,可以看到列表[1, 2, 3, 4, 5]的算術平均值為3.0。
除了使用自己編寫的函數,Python還提供了一個內置函數來計算算術平均值。使用內置函數可以讓代碼更加簡潔,如下所示:
numbers = [1, 2, 3, 4, 5] avg = sum(numbers) / len(numbers) print('算術平均值為:', avg)
該程序與先前的程序輸出相同。
通過學習Python計算算術平均值的方法,可以更好地理解這一重要概念,并在編寫程序時輕松地計算平均值。